2018-11-19 07:00
1832
0
Java,小刀爱编程,,详解java并发包源码之AQS独占方法源码分析
AQS 的实现原理 学完用 AQS 自定义一个锁以后,我们可以来看一下刚刚使用过的方法的实现。 分析源码的时候会省略一些不重要的代码。 AQS 的实现是基于一个 FIFO 队列的,每一个等待的线程被封...
|
2018-11-19 07:00
2771
0
JFinal,山东-小木,imhoodoo,搞定了微信小程序富文本渲染解决方案-后端渲染方案Html2Wxml2J
先介绍一下最近遇到的问题: 最近小程序项目中有文章详情页需要渲染富文本,微信小程序官方提供的<rich-text>是个弱鸡,很多标签不支持,用起来也麻烦,性能也不咋地。 吐槽完了,我们决定...
|
2018-11-19 07:00
2125
0
Temporal,ECMAScript,peakedness丶,,ES6中let 和 const 的新特性
在javascript中,我们都知道使用var来声明变量。javascript是函数级作用域,函数内可以访问函数外的变量,函数外不能访问函数内的变量。 ECMAScript 6 是 JavaScrip...
|
2018-11-19 07:00
2107
0
logback,程序猿DD,didispace,Logback中如何自定义灵活的日志过滤规则
当我们需要对日志的打印要做一些范围的控制的时候,通常都是通过为各个Appender设置不同的Filter配置来实现。在Logback中自带了两个过滤器实现:ch.qos.logback.classic...
|
2018-11-18 09:00
2628
0
Spring,Dubbo,Spring Boot,initializr,spi,Jacktanger,javamaster,SpringBoot源码:启动过程分析(一)
本文主要分析 SpringBoot 的启动过程。 SpringBoot的版本为:2.1.0 release,最新版本。 一.时序图 还是老套路,先把分析过程的时序图摆出来:时序图-SpringBoot...
|
2018-11-17 08:00
2437
0
InfluxDB,curl,Redis,iOS,Axios,前端攻城老湿,,node上的redis调用优化示例
Node.js读写数据到influxDB,目前已经有一个库node-influx, 这个库功能非常强大,但是我个人使用这个库的时候,遇到无法解决的问题。 使用curl都可以写数据到influxDB,但...
|
2018-11-17 08:00
1954
0
Dubbo,小刀爱编程,,Dubbo 源码分析
1. 简介 在上一篇文章中,我详细的分析了服务导出的原理。本篇文章我们趁热打铁,继续分析服务引用的原理。在 Dubbo 中,我们可以通过两种方式引用远程服务。第一种是使用服务直联的方式引用......
|
2018-11-17 08:00
2773
0
Bash,OpenJDK,Supervisor,Supervisord,Jenkins,jimmywa,jimmywa,搭建jenkins主从集群
1. 检查服务器包配置[可选] 一般不需要apt的额外配置, 如果有删除配置或者移动到别处, 使其不生效: sudo rm /etc/apt/apt.conf sudo apt-get update ...
|
2018-11-17 08:00
1774
0
Redis Cluster,Redis,James-,,用Redis轻松实现秒杀系统
导论 曾经被问过好多次怎样实现秒杀系统的问题。昨天又在CSDN架构师微信群被问到了。因此这里把我设想的实现秒杀系统的价格设计分享出来。供大家参考。 秒杀系统的架构设计 秒杀系统,是典型......
|
2018-11-17 08:00
1945
0
Vue-Router,Vue.js,peakedness丶,,深入理解Vue router的部分高级用法
今天要介绍的是路由元信息,滚动行为以及路由懒加载这几个的使用方法。 1.路由元信息 什么是路由元信息,看看官网的解释,定义路由的时候可以配置 meta 字段可以匹配meta字段,那么我们该如何......
|
2018-11-16 16:00
2406
0
Safari,Chrome,会写代码的husky,huskydog,new Date() 在Safari下的 Invalid Date问题
问题复现 var timeStr = '2018-11-11 00:00:00'; var time = new Date(timeStr); // error: Invalid Date ... 在...
|
2018-11-16 16:00
2428
0
lu-s,,程序员,你怎么对待常见的数据一致性问题?
现象 应用系统中的关键服务绝大部分都会是对数据库的依赖。 当多个进程同时操作同一个数据,会产生资源争抢,数据一致性的问题。 如果只有一个数据库服务器,数据一致性问题也就不存在了。 ......
|
2018-11-16 16:00
2042
0
Vue.js,peakedness丶,,Vue瀑布流插件的使用示例
我自己写的一个的Vue瀑布流插件,列数自适应,不用设置每个卡片的高度。 测试页面:Page.vue 模板页面:WaterFollow.vue 和 WFColumn.vue 在Page.vue中,修改i...
|
2018-11-16 10:00
2577
0
Koa,peakedness丶,,Koa项目搭建过程详细记录
Java中的Spring MVC加MyBatis基本上已成为Java Web的标配。Node JS上对应的有Koa、Express、Mongoose、Sequelize等。Koa一定程度上可以说是Ex...
|
2018-11-15 21:00
2130
0
Vue.js,BetterScroll,前端攻城老湿,,vue2中引用 better-scroll的方法
文章主要介绍了vue2中引用better-scroll和使用 better-scroll的方法,使用时有三个要点及注意事项在文中给大家详细介绍 ,需要的朋友可以参考下 使用时有三个要点: 一:html...
|
2018-11-15 18:00
2670
0
ykbj,ykbj,在Portainer中部署Docker监控系统(cAdvisor+InfluxDB+Grafana)
在Coreos系统中我们一般利用Portainer容器来管理Docker,可以看我的其他文章(coreos和portainer都有讲到过) 全容器化的部署方式下,我们可以利用cAdvisor+Infl...
|
2018-11-15 18:00
1912
0
PVM,Python,Python女神,,Python函数属性和PyCodeObject
函数属性 python中的函数是一种对象,它有属于对象的属性。除此之外,函数还可以自定义自己的属性。注意,属性是和对象相关的,和作用域无关。 自定义属性 自定义函数自己的属性方式很简单。......
|
2018-11-15 18:00
2580
0
Dubbo,别打我会飞,,阿里巴巴Dubbo实现的源码分析
1. Dubbo概述 Dubbo是阿里巴巴开源出来的一个分布式服务框架,致力于提供高性能和透明化的RPC远程服务调用方案,以及作为SOA服务治理的方案。它的核心功能包括: #remoting:远程通讯...
|
2018-11-15 17:00
2503
0
React,Virtual DOM,ReactJS,peakedness丶,,浅谈React的最大亮点——虚拟DOM
在Web开发中,需要将数据的变化实时反映到UI上,这时就需要对DOM进行操作,但是复杂或频繁的DOM操作通常是性能瓶颈产生的原因,为此,React引入了虚拟DOM(Virtual DOM)的机制。 一...
|
2018-11-15 17:00
1997
1
Vue.js,前端攻城老湿,,vue组件中的样式属性scoped实例
vue组件中的style标签标有scoped属性时表明style里的css样式只适用于当前组件元素 。接下来通过本文给大家分享vue组件中的样式属性scoped实例详解 **Scoped CSS** ...
|